Maintaining Your PV System: Simple Maintenance Advice

To guarantee the efficiency and output of your PV power installation, routine maintenance is really important. While solar panels are built to be durable, a little care can go a significant way. Start with occasional visual checks for any clear damage, such as cracks or fading. Remove debris from your panels frequently, especially in regions with a significant amount of dirt. Using gentle solution and a gentle brush will reduce scratching. It's also advisable to get a professional PV technician perform a more thorough review at least once several years, which may involve checking wiring and electrical connections. Remember, preventative maintenance is typically more cost-effective than addressing major problems down the road.

Solar Panel Technology Explained

At its core, photovoltaic panel design harnesses light from the star and alters it directly into power. This process relies on conductive materials, most commonly silicon, which are treated to create a upward and a negative layer. When radiance strikes these layers, it releases electrons, creating an electric flow – the electricity we use. Different types of solar panels exist, including single-crystal which are typically more efficient but more costly, and polycrystalline which are generally less expensive but slightly less efficient. Ongoing research is focused on refining panel output, reducing prices, and investigating new materials like perovskites to further revolutionize photovoltaic power production.
